After hitting the mark with their first footwear capsule collection last year, Italian footwear brand Diemme and luxury outerwear giant Ten C are back at it, teaming up for an exciting second collection — and it’s just as good as the first one.

The new Anterselva capsule blends Diemme’s Italian craftsmanship with Ten C’s innovative design DNA, creating the perfect hybrid for urban streets and outdoor terrain. At the core of this collection is the iconic Diemme Rosset, known for its rugged look and built to be your go-to companion for any mountain adventure.

Handcrafted entirely in Italy, the new Anterselva takes its name from the beautiful alpine lake in Bolzano. With a sturdy sole and a chunky rubber band that wraps around to connect and protect the sole and upper, this design keeps all the trekking functionality without sacrificing aesthetics. Diemme’s high-quality Italian leather production and Ten C’s exclusive patented fabric OJJ (Original Japanese Jerseys) partner up for ultimate support, keeping you comfortable throughout your journey (so you can blame all those blisters on your enthusiasm instead). 

The new Anterselva collection is all set to be unisex, and available in three neutral colors.
